Transaction 51a52662d86722bf87ba7f97925ab2e2b6fca05554b26c9bc627c062d7711757
1 Input
1 Output
-
51a52662d86722bf87ba7f97925ab2e2b6fca05554b26c9bc627c062d7711757:0
- value
- 24079224
- script pubkey
- OP_0 OP_PUSHBYTES_20 34dac9c28ab66fbc7fa7e8410b2190d2bdfd04b4
- address
- bc1qxndvns52kehmcla8apqskgvs627l6p95mle2d6